North Stamford is the leafy, semi-rural northern section of Stamford, Connecticut, a neighborhood of winding roads and larger properties within one of the Northeast's wealthiest corridors. Its mental health concerns track affluent Fairfield County life — high-achievement family pressure, commuter strain, and the isolation that spread-out living can bring, particularly for older residents. Stamford's and Fairfield County's strong private therapy market serves the area.
Life Coaching therapists in North Stamford, CT Statistics
Life Coaching therapists in North Stamford, CT average 20 years of experience and charge around $202 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(60%), Family Systems Therapy (36%), and Psychodynamic Therapy (35%).
